Japan Considering To Re-Open Borders To Travellers From Selected Countries

It is reported that Japan is considering to re-open its borders to foreign travelers, but, it will be from selected countries that have low levels of COVID-19 infections.

According to Reuters, Japan’s government is planning to allow travelers from 4 countries that is Thailand, Vietnam, Australia, and New Zealand for the upcoming months.

Travelers from those 4 countries may enter Japan if tested negative COVID-19 in two separate tests that were done that are upon departure from their home country and when arrive in Japan.

When travelers can enter the country, their movements would be restricted to areas including place of stay, company offices, and factories. Not just that, the use of public transport was also banned.

Before this, Japan has already banned the entry of foreign travelers since February to reduce the spread of the virus. For now, it has been reported that more than 16,000 and almost 900 deaths COVID-19 cases have been confirmed in Japan.
